Job Purpose
The Standards and Training Officer will support the Quality Supervisor by assisting with the implementation, monitoring, and documentation of training and quality standards across operational teams. This role will focus on ensuring adherence to established procedures and providing guidance on training requirements. The ST Officer will work independently on specified tasks, requiring specialized knowledge in training standards.
Job Description
Training Support and Documentation
- Collaborate with the Standards and Training Coordinator to develop, revise, and refine training materials, ensuring they are up-to-date with current policies and practices.
- Organize and maintain a comprehensive database of training resources, including manuals, presentations, guides, and instructional materials, to support field and operational staff effectively.
- Facilitate the documentation of all training sessions, including attendance records, training evaluations, and feedback forms, to ensure accurate and complete records of all activities.
- Support the delivery of training sessions by preparing materials, setting up venues, and coordinating with trainers and attendees for efficient session flow.
- Deliver specific mine action theory and practical lessons in line with personal qualifications and experiences as directed by the STC.
- Develop summary reports on training activities, participation rates, and feedback, contributing to evaluations of training effectiveness and areas for improvement.
- Conduct monthly stockchecks of Free From Explosive (FFE) items used in training.
Quality Assurance and Compliance Monitoring
- Conduct regular quality assurance and quality control checks on technical operations and training to verify adherence to established standards and guidelines, reporting any non-compliance or deviations.
- Ensure accurate completion of Quality Assurance Evaluation Forms (QAEF) ensuring non-conformities are justified with reference to MAG Iraq SOPs and policies. Immediately advise QS and STM of any critical non-conformities.
